Paccar (PCAR) Rises Higher Than Market: Key Facts

Paccar (PCAR - Free Report) ended the recent trading session at $99.34, demonstrating a +1.16% change from the preceding day's closing price. The stock's change was more than the S&P 500's daily gain of 0.48%. Meanwhile, the Dow experienced a drop of 0.02%, and the technology-dominated Nasdaq saw an increase of 0.94%.

Prior to today's trading, shares of the truck maker had gained 4.96% outpaced the Auto-Tires-Trucks sector's loss of 7.77% and lagged the S&P 500's gain of 5.13%.

The investment community will be paying close attention to the earnings performance of Paccar in its upcoming release. The company is forecasted to report an EPS of $1.29, showcasing a 39.44% downward movement from the corresponding quarter of the prior year. Meanwhile, our latest consensus estimate is calling for revenue of $6.81 billion, down 17.63% from the prior-year quarter.

In terms of the entire fiscal year, the Zacks Consensus Estimates predict earnings of $5.72 per share and a revenue of $27.75 billion, indicating changes of -27.59% and -12.09%, respectively, from the former year.

Over the past month, there's been no change in the Zacks Consensus EPS estimate. Paccar presently features a Zacks Rank of #4 (Sell).

In terms of valuation, Paccar is presently being traded at a Forward P/E ratio of 17.17. This denotes a premium relative to the industry average Forward P/E of 11.81.

We can also see that PCAR currently has a PEG ratio of 3.63. The PEG ratio bears resemblance to the frequently used P/E ratio, but this parameter also includes the company's expected earnings growth trajectory. The Automotive - Domestic industry had an average PEG ratio of 1.2 as trading concluded yesterday.

The Automotive - Domestic industry is part of the Auto-Tires-Trucks sector. With its current Zacks Industry Rank of 213, this industry ranks in the bottom 14% of all industries, numbering over 250.
